Fluent Fiction - Turkish: Sipping Legacy: Balancing Tradition and Modernity Find the full episode transcript, vocabulary words, and more:fluentfiction.com/tr/episode/2026-02-19-08-38-20-tr Story Transcript:Tr: İstanbul'un kalbinde, eski bir sokağın köşesinde, küçük ve sıcacık bir kafe vardı.En: In the heart of İstanbul, on the corner of an old street, there was a small and cozy café.Tr: Hava soğuktu, dükkanın önündeki camlar buharlanmıştı.En: The weather was cold, and the windows in front of the shop were fogged up.Tr: Burası Eren, Zeynep ve Tamer'in aile kafesiydi.En: This was the family café of Eren, Zeynep, and Tamer.Tr: Gençken burada oynar, ders çalışır, annelerine yardım ederlerdi.En: In their youth, they used to play here, study, and help their mother.Tr: Eren, kardeşler arasında en büyüğüydü.En: Eren was the oldest among the siblings.Tr: Kafenin duvarlarında, eski aile fotoğraflarının altında oturuyordu ve derin düşüncelere dalmıştı.En: He was sitting under the old family photos on the café’s walls, lost in deep thoughts.Tr: Kafe annelerinden miras kalmıştı.En: The café had been inherited from their mother.Tr: Eren, bu mirası koruma sorumluluğunu hissediyordu.En: Eren felt the responsibility of preserving this legacy.Tr: Direkt olarak bir şey söyleyemese de, içinde ailesi için başarmak istiyordu.En: Even though he couldn't directly express it, he wanted to succeed for his family.Tr: Zeynep, mantıklı ama kararsızdı.En: Zeynep was logical but indecisive.Tr: "Eren," dedi çayını yudumlarken, "Bu yer bizim, ama belki de farklı bir şey yapmalıyız.En: "Eren," she said while sipping her tea, "This place is ours, but maybe we should do something different.Tr: En azından bir menü değişikliği olabilir."En: At least a menu change could be possible."Tr: Tamer ise hayalleriyle dolup taşan genç bir idealistti.En: On the other hand, Tamer was a young idealist overflowing with dreams.Tr: "Biliyorum.En: "I know.Tr: Burayı modernize edelim.En: Let's modernize this place.Tr: Daha çok müşteri çekeriz.En: We can attract more customers.Tr: İstanbul'un yeni trendlerine ayak uyduralım," diyerek hevesle konuşuyordu.En: Let's keep up with the new trends of İstanbul," he said eagerly.Tr: Gülümsese de içinde yeni çağa ayak uydurmanın gerekliliği vardı.En: Though he smiled, there was a necessity inside him to adapt to the new era.Tr: Eren, kardeşleri arasında bir çatışma hissediyordu.En: Eren sensed a conflict among his siblings.Tr: Bir akşam, kafede otururken karar verdi.En: One evening, while sitting in the café, he made a decision.Tr: "Hadi hep beraber oturalım.En: "Let's sit down, all of us.Tr: Konuşmamız lazım," diyerek kardeşlerine seslendi.En: We need to talk," he called out to his siblings.Tr: Kardeşler toplanınca, Eren ciddi bir yüz ifadesiyle başladı.En: When the siblings gathered, Eren began with a serious expression.Tr: "Anne ve babamızı, onların hayallerini unutmak istemiyorum.En: "I don't want to forget our parents and their dreams.Tr: Ama sizin isteklerinizi de dinlemeliyim.En: But I must also listen to your wishes.Tr: Ortada bir yol bulalım."En: Let's find a middle ground."Tr: Herkes sustu.En: Everyone fell silent.Tr: Kafe dışındaki rüzgarın sesi gündemlerini böldü.En: The sound of the wind outside the café interrupted their agenda.Tr: Zeynep, bir süre düşündükten sonra konuştu.En: After thinking for a while, Zeynep spoke.Tr: "Belki dekorasyonu yenileyebiliriz, ama ruha dokunmayacak bir şekilde."En: "Maybe we can renew the decoration, but in a way that doesn't touch the spirit."Tr: Tamer heyecanla ekledi, "Ve ayrıca sosyal medyada yer alabiliriz.En: Tamer excitedly added, "And we can also be on social media.Tr: Eren, senin dediğin gibi, annemizdeki samimiyeti bozmaz."En: Eren, like you said, it won't ruin the sincerity we had from our mom."Tr: Sonunda hepsi başlarını salladı.En: In the end, they all nodded.Tr: Eren, bir eylem planı yaparken gülümsedi.En: Eren smiled as he made an action plan.Tr: Kardeşlerinin düşüncelerine saygı duymayı ve aynı zamanda ailesinin mirasını yaşatmayı öğrenmişti.En: He had learned to respect his siblings' thoughts while keeping his family's legacy alive.Tr: Soğuk kış mevsimi, kafenin içindeki sıcak ve samimi atmosferle ısınmıştı.En: The cold winter season warmed with the warm and sincere atmosphere inside the café.Tr: Böylece, Eren, Zeynep ve Tamer ortak bir kararla, geçmişin zarafetini geleceğin yenilikleriyle buluşturdular.En: Thus, Eren, Zeynep, and Tamer united in a joint decision, blending the elegance of the past with the innovations of the future.Tr: Kafe, İstanbul'un hala o eski sıcaklığı ve yeni bir geleceğin heyecanı ile ayakta kalmayı başardı.En: The café managed to stand strong with the old warmth of İstanbul and the excitement of a new future. Vocabulary Words:cozy: sıcacıkfogged: buharlanmıştıinherited: miras kalmıştıresponsibility: sorumluluğunupreserving: korumalegacy: miraslogical: mantıklıindecisive: kararsızmenu: menüidealist: idealistmodernize: modernize edelimtrends: trendlerineconflict: çatışmagathered: toplanıncaexpression: yüz ifadesidreams: hayallerinisilent: sustuwind: rüzgaragenda: gündemlerinidecorations: dekorasyonuspirit: ruhasincerity: samimiyetirespect: saygıelegance: zarafetiniinnovations: yenilikleriyleexcitement: heyecanımiddle ground: ortada bir yolrenew: yenileyebilirizatmosphere: atmosferlesiblings: kardeşler
